AI Summary

  • Requires the South Coast Air Quality Management District to update Rule 1157 governing PM10 emissions from aggregate and cement operations to improve air quality and increase data collection

  • By January 1, 2027, covered facilities must maintain fencing at least 6 inches taller than their tallest storage pile, install fence-line PM10 monitoring systems, and limit open storage piles to 8 feet high if located within 500 feet of sensitive receptors (residences, schools, hospitals, parks, daycare facilities)

  • Facilities must cease operations and implement dust mitigation if PM10 emissions reach threshold limits, and must notify the district and provide public notice when thresholds are exceeded

  • Starting July 1, 2027, facilities with a history of PM10 emissions at or above threshold limits and within 500 feet of sensitive receptors must fully enclose open storage piles

  • Requires facilities to display signage informing the public about Rule 1157, potential violations, and how to submit complaints to the district
